UPSC CSE — Overview

The UPSC Civil Services Examination (CSE) is India's most prestigious and challenging government exam, conducted by the Union Public Service Commission to recruit officers for the IAS, IPS, IFS and other central Group A and Group B services. The three-stage process — Preliminary (objective screening), Mains (nine descriptive papers) and a Personality Test (interview) — assesses a candidate's knowledge, analytical ability, writing skill and personality over nearly a year. Cracking UPSC CSE opens the door to the country's top administrative and policy-making roles.

UPSC CSE Exam Pattern & Format

Marks, duration, number of questions and marking scheme.
Prelims: two objective papers — General Studies Paper I and CSAT (Paper II, qualifying). Mains: nine descriptive papers (Essay, four GS papers, two optional-subject papers, two qualifying language papers). Personality Test (interview).

UPSC CSE — Frequently Asked Questions

How many stages are in UPSC CSE?

Three: the Preliminary exam (objective screening), the Main exam (nine descriptive papers) and the Personality Test/interview.

What is the UPSC CSE age limit?

Generally 21 to 32 years for the general category, with relaxations and a limited number of attempts for reserved categories.
